How much do intern lab jobs pay per hour?

As of May 29, 2026, the average hourly pay for intern lab in the United States is $17.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Intern Lab,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Intern Lab, you generally need a foundational understanding of scientific principles, laboratory safety, and basic research techniques, often supported by coursework in biology, chemistry, or a related field. Familiarity with laboratory equipment, data analysis software (such as Excel or specialized lab databases), and adherence to standard operating procedures is important. Attention to detail, effective communication, and a willingness to learn help interns excel in collaborative and dynamic lab environments. These skills ensure accurate data collection, safe operations, and meaningful contributions to ongoing research projects.

What types of projects or tasks can an Intern Lab expect to work on during their internship?

As an Intern Lab, you can expect to engage in a variety of hands-on projects, such as assisting with experiments, collecting and analyzing data, preparing laboratory materials, and supporting routine maintenance of equipment. You'll likely collaborate closely with supervisors, researchers, and other interns, giving you exposure to different aspects of laboratory work. This experience not only helps you develop technical skills but also provides insight into the day-to-day operations and teamwork essential in a professional lab environment.

What are Intern Lab positions?

Intern Lab positions are entry-level roles typically offered to students or recent graduates in laboratory settings. These internships provide hands-on experience in conducting experiments, managing lab equipment, and assisting with research projects under the supervision of experienced scientists or technicians. The goal is to help interns develop practical skills, gain exposure to laboratory protocols, and understand the day-to-day operations of a lab environment. Intern Lab roles can be found in a variety of fields, including biology, chemistry, medical research, and engineering.

What is the difference between Intern Lab vs Research Assistant?

AspectIntern LabResearch Assistant
Required CredentialsTypically students or entry-level, some may have relevant courseworkUsually requires a bachelor's degree, often pursuing or holding a master's or PhD
Work EnvironmentEducational or training setting, supervised by professionalsResearch labs, academic institutions, or industry, with more independent responsibilities
Employer & Industry UsageUniversities, research institutes, companies for trainingUniversities, research organizations, industry R&D departments

Intern Lab positions are primarily educational roles for students gaining experience, while Research Assistants are more advanced roles involving active research responsibilities. Both roles support research activities but differ in experience level and independence.

Job description

Position Title: Intern, Lab Assistant

Location: Morris Plains, NJ

Reports to: Technical Director, Retail Hair

ABOUT THE WELLA COMPANY 

Together,WEenable individuals to look, feel, and be their true selves. 

WellaCompany is one of the world's leading beauty companies, comprised of a family of iconic brands such as Wella Professionals, Clairol, OPI, Nioxin and ghd. With 6,000 employees globally, presence in over 100 countries, WellaCompany and its brands enable consumers to look, feel, and be their true selves. As innovators in the hair and nail industry, WellaCompany empowers its people to delight consumers, inspire beauty professionals, engage communities, and deliver sustainable growth to its stakeholders. 

For additional information about the Wella Company please visit www.wellacompany.com.  

THE ROLE 

As a Lab Assistant Intern you will....

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ES  

  • Ability to effectively communicate with project team and build effective working relationships.
  • Learn to operate all lab processing equipment and follow established lab procedures.
  • Batch Preparation: Hair Color (Liquid/Creme/Gels), Hair Color Developers
  • Batch Analysis: pH, Viscosity, Weights, Temp and Visual Inspection,
  • Tress Dye-Outs and Color Assessment
  • Quality Lab Practices: Equipment calibration, raw material handling, inventory labeling and transfer, product disposal, data entry and reporting
  • Finished product preparation: Packing and labeling bulk product, assistance with labeling and shipping.
  • Complete all projects and associated tasks on time and to the standard of project managers.

QUALIFICATIONS 

  • Associate Degree in a science-related field (completed or in progress) with prior lab experience, or a 4-year BS degree in Chemistry, Biology, or another applied science-related field.
  • Lab experience, preference in the Hair Color/Care lab or formulated wet chemistry. 
  • Passion for learning about analytical chemistry principles and methods with the ability to execute experiments and accurately record results.
  • Technical Data Reporting skills and detailed attention to follow SOPs, Test Methods, and Work Instructions.
  • Highly proficient in usage of IT tools - Proficiency with Microsoft Word and Excel
  • Team player with 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ously.
  • Ability to work independently.

The hourly wage for this role is $19-20/hr.
